可移动液压式整体升降楼板脚手架设计与计算

         

摘要

Aiming at the present stage building floor type of full house scaffold,large amount of labor workers are used,the labor intensity is high,the erection period is longer.And there are some security risks and other shortcomings.A high degree of mechanization of a new integral lifting floor scaffold is proposed for the first time in this paper.Its structural configuration is designed,and its components and specifications of timber is calculated.It is proved this new scaffold can achieve the propose of safe and reliable.Its operation is simple,and it can save time.%针对现阶段房屋建筑楼板满堂式脚手架搭设中,工人劳动量大、强度高且搭设工期较长,存在安全隐患等缺点,提出一种机械化程度较高的新型整体升降楼板脚手架.对该脚手架进行构造设计并计算各构件的用材及规格,证明其具有可行性,能达到安全可靠,操作简单,省时省力的目的.
